How to Implement a Barcode Inventory System

Inventory management is a crucial part of any business that handles goods, from retail to manufacturing. Traditional methods often fall short in efficiency and accuracy, but a barcode inventory management system can streamline operations, reduce errors, and save time and money.

In this post, we’ll explore what a barcode inventory system is, why it’s beneficial, and how to implement one effectively.

What are Barcodes?

barcode inventory management system

A barcode is a method of representing data visually, readable by machines (like scanners). It consists of a series of parallel lines and spaces of varying widths that can be scanned and translated into a string of characters, which then provides specific information about the product.

This data typically relates to a particular item’s identity, like its manufacturer, product type, and size, and it’s crucial for inventory management, pricing, and checkout processes.

How Do Barcodes Work?

The operation of barcodes is straightforward but ingenious. A barcode scanner beams light on the code and then measures the amount absorbed and reflected. The dark bars on a barcode absorb light and the white spaces reflect it. Thus, the scanner translates the pattern of light and dark into digital data that is then decoded into characters.

Types of Barcodes

Barcodes come in many different formats, but they are generally categorized into two main types: linear (or 1D) and matrix (or 2D) barcodes.

1. Linear Barcodes:

  • UPC (Universal Product Code): The most common type of barcode in the United States, used in retail to identify product details.

  • EAN (European Article Number): Similar to UPC, it is more common in international settings.

  • Code 128: Widely used for packaging and shipping, it is versatile and can encode all 128 characters of ASCII.

1D Barcode

2. Matrix Barcodes:

  • QR Codes (Quick Response Codes): Can store a lot of data, including URL links, which makes them popular for marketing and information sharing via smartphones.

  • Data Matrix: Often used in healthcare and electronics industries for its small size and large data capacity.

2D Barcode

Advantages of Using Barcodes

Efficiency: Barcodes reduce the likelihood of human error. The chances of errors in manually entered data are significantly higher than those in barcodes scanned.

Speed: Scanning barcodes is much faster than typing data manually, speeding up the checkout process and inventory management.

Cost-Effective: Barcode systems are not expensive to implement and they offer a high return on investment due to increased efficiency and accuracy.

Versatility: Barcodes are extremely versatile. They can be used for any kind of necessary data collection. This could include pricing or inventory information, or even more detailed data in manufacturing or logistics.

How Does a Barcode Inventory System Work?

A barcode inventory system is nothing more but an inventory management software that utilizes barcodes to track inventory, including those stored in a warehouse and those moving through various sales channels.

It consists of 4 major components:

1. Barcode System:
Each item in inventory is assigned a unique barcode that usually encodes information such as product number, serial number, and batch number. This barcode can be printed directly on the item, on a sticker, or on the packaging.

2. Scanning Devices:
These are used to read the barcode and can range from handheld scanners to mobile devices equipped with scanning apps, or fixed scanners installed at checkout counters or warehouse stations.

3. Barcode Printers:
For businesses that need to generate their own barcodes, such as manufacturing components or private label retailers, barcode printers are essential. They can print barcodes on labels which are then attached to the products.

4. Inventory Management Software:
This is the core of a barcode inventory system. The software receives data from the barcode scanners and uses it to maintain an up-to-date record of inventory levels, locations, movements, and sales. The software can also generate actionable reports, send restock alerts, and even automate ordering processes.

Benefits of Implementing a Barcode Inventory System

Barcode inventory systems offer numerous benefits. Here are a few of them:

1. Enhanced Accuracy

Manual data entry is susceptible to errors. Humans can easily mistype numbers, forget to input data, or input data into the wrong fields. A barcode system significantly reduces these errors. By scanning barcodes, the data entered into inventory systems is both accurate and consistent. This precision is crucial for maintaining reliable records on stock levels, prices, and product locations.

2. Increased Efficiency

Barcode scanning is much faster than manual entry. During both inventory counts and at the point of sale, items can be processed quickly and effortlessly. This speed not only boosts productivity but also enhances customer satisfaction by speeding up the checkout process. In inventory management, it means being able to do frequent inventories without the additional time and labor costs typically involved.

3. Real-Time Data

A barcode inventory system allows for real-time tracking of inventory. This means that the moment a barcode is scanned, the relevant data is updated in the system. This instant data update provides businesses with up-to-date information, allowing for more accurate and timely decision-making. For instance, it helps in identifying trends in sales, managing stock levels more effectively, and even forecasting future demands.

4. Cost Reduction

Although setting up a barcode system may require some initial investment, the long-term savings are significant. The reduction in labor for data entry and inventory checks, the decrease in errors that might require costly corrections, and the improved efficiency all contribute to substantial cost savings. Moreover, it helps in reducing excess inventory and minimizing the costs associated with holding too much stock.

5. Better Inventory Control

Barcodes give businesses a better grip on their inventory. Each item can be tracked through its barcode from the moment it enters the inventory until it leaves. This tracking helps prevent issues such as overstocking or stockouts. It also facilitates a more streamlined approach to reordering and inventory forecasting.

6. Scalability

A barcode system can grow with your business. It’s scalable, meaning new products can be easily added to the system, and additional scanners and software can be integrated. Whether you’re expanding product lines or need more comprehensive tracking, barcode systems can accommodate that growth without a significant overhaul.

Steps to Implement a Barcode Inventory Management System

Step 1: Evaluate Your Needs

Before diving into a barcode system, assess your current inventory management needs. Consider the size of your inventory, the complexity of your supply chain, and the specific challenges you face. This assessment will help you determine the scope of the system required, including the type of barcodes, scanners, and inventory management software that best fits your needs.

Step 2: Select the Right Barcode Technology

Barcodes come in various forms, primarily differentiated as 1D (linear) barcodes and 2D (QR codes and other formats). 1D barcodes are suitable for most consumer goods and are simpler to implement. In contrast, 2D barcodes can store more information and are beneficial in environments where space on labels is limited or more data needs to be encoded.

Step 3: Choose Your Hardware and Software

  • Hardware: You’ll need barcode scanners and printers. Scanners can be wired or wireless, handheld or stationary, depending on your operations. Printers must be capable of producing high-quality barcode labels that are readable and durable.

  • Software: Choose inventory management software that supports barcode scanning and offers features needed for your business, such as real-time data tracking, easy integration with existing systems, and comprehensive reporting tools.

Step 4: Design and Implement Barcode Labels

Design your barcode labels to include all necessary information, such as product ID, price, and possibly an expiration date. Ensure the labels are readable and placed consistently on products to facilitate easy scanning. It’s important that the label materials and adhesives are suitable for the storage conditions and handling of your products.

Step 5: Set Up Your Inventory Database

Your inventory management software will need a complete database of all inventory items with associated barcodes. Input product information into the database or integrate it with your existing system. This database will be the backbone of your inventory management, as it will be updated in real-time with every scan.

Step 6: Train Your Staff

Training is crucial for the successful adoption of any new system. Educate your staff on how to use barcode scanners and software. Ensure they understand the process of scanning items accurately, managing data entry, and troubleshooting common issues.

Step 7: Test the System

Before going fully live, conduct thorough testing to ensure everything works as expected. Run several scenarios to check the accuracy of the barcode scanning, the responsiveness of the software, and the robustness of the data handling. Make adjustments based on feedback and ensure that your network and hardware can handle the system under different loads.

Step 8: Go Live and Monitor

Implement the system throughout your operations. Monitor the system closely for the first few weeks to handle any unforeseen issues quickly. Keep an eye on performance metrics and seek feedback from users to fine-tune processes and training.

Tips to Maintain a Barcode Inventory System

Implementing a barcode inventory system is only half the work; maintaining it to keep it in perfect working condition is another half. Here are some helpful tips to consider:

1. Regularly Update Software

Keep your inventory management software up to date. Software developers frequently release updates that improve functionality, add new features, and fix bugs. These updates are crucial for maintaining security, enhancing performance, and ensuring compatibility with other technology in your stack. Schedule regular checks for software updates and apply them promptly.

2. Conduct Frequent Hardware Inspections

Barcode scanners, printers, and other hardware are susceptible to wear and tear, especially in high-usage environments. Regular inspections can help catch issues before they lead to system failure. Check for signs of damage or malfunction, such as difficulty in scanning barcodes or poor print quality from barcode printers. Clean your devices according to the manufacturer’s instructions to prevent build-up that might interfere with their operation.

3. Train and Re-train Staff

Human error can quickly undermine the effectiveness of a barcode inventory system. Regular training sessions for new and existing staff are vital. Ensure everyone understands how to operate the scanners, manage the software, and follow the standard procedures for data entry and inventory handling. Periodic refresher courses can help maintain high standards and introduce new staff to the system.

Move Your Business Forward With Uphance

If you run a fashion brand and need an inventory management software with a barcode system, then Uphance is your best bet!

With Uphance, you can easily assign barcodes to your products. With the assigned barcodes, you can easily track your products as they move along your sales channels and warehouse.

Ready to take Uphance for a spin? Schedule a demo right away.

Table of Contents